What is the 2013 Ohio Agriculture Contest Entry Form?
The 2013 Ohio Agriculture Contest Entry Form is an essential document for students looking to participate in a competitive event organized by the Ohio Department of Agriculture. This form is pivotal for students and parents, as it facilitates the submission of various entries, including video, photographs, paintings, and drawings. By utilizing this form, students can showcase their creativity and talent while contributing to an important agricultural initiative.
The entry form not only serves as a mechanism for submission but also emphasizes the importance of engaging with agricultural themes through art and creativity.

Who is eligible to submit this form?
Eligibility for the 2013 Ohio Agriculture Contest Entry Form includes any student wishing to participate in the contest, with entries needing parent or guardian signatures for submission.
What is the deadline for submitting this form?
Entries must be postmarked by May 15, 2013. Ensure that you allow enough time for mailing to meet this deadline.
How should I submit the completed form?
The completed form should be mailed to the Ohio Department of Agriculture's designated address. Ensure you follow all submission instructions outlined on the form.
